Developed by “Naked Rain” which is a subsidiary of ThunderFire….. which is yet another subsidiary of Chinese telecom giant, NetEase comes Project Mugen.

Very few snippets of actual gameplay footage is shown during its reveal trailer, but primarily this F2P title is set in a massive open world of a futuristic city with various opens for traversing your environment, such as driving vehicles, wall riding or swinging atop high rise buildings with a grappling hook like mechanic, similarly to the Just Cause franchise.

And of course there’s bound to be lots of hidden secrets and other things discoverable if you’re one to take your time taking in the sights and sounds of the overworld, traverse on foot, visit one of the many train stations in the city,

Combat also varied greatly depending on the character played, melee, firing weapons, even psychokinetic abilities, pick up and drop a whole fucking car on your foes, all can be done in Project Mugen.
